A member asked:

I had pcr test done and regular blood work for hsv1 and i was negative. never had a sore . i recently did regular blood work now hsv1 is positive. ?

Typical: Not sure why "regular blood work" would include HSV1, but becoming positive without having any symptoms or signs of infection is very common. Most people who test positive can't really say when they might have been infected. Very unlikely to be infectious if no sores present, but most prudent would inform potential intimates--from kissers to lovers. Good wishes:)
